Re: Retirement of the Stonebriar product line

Stonebriar sales have declined for five consecutive quarters and support costs now exceed contribution margin. The retirement plan is staged: new orders close end of Q2, existing contracts honoured through their terms, and spares stocked for twenty-four months. Sales leads should steer prospects toward the Ashgrove range; migration incentives are already approved. Customer comms are drafted and awaiting legal sign-off. The forward strategy behind this decision is set out in the note below.

confidential, yafog-hagug: Gross margin on Druix came in at 10 percent against a plan of 15 percent. Only 5 of the 80 pilot accounts renewed Druix, so a churn review is set for October 1.

Ticket: Config drift in Coinrelay rounding settings. Support has been fielding reports of one-cent discrepancies in converted totals. Root cause: the rounding mode and precision settings on two conversion workers no longer match the baseline, so identical conversions round differently depending on which worker handles them. Refunds issued in the interim may need manual adjustment. Until the drift is corrected, compare any affected account against the intended values below.

config for kagup-hahig:
druwyn:
  pin: 2801
  metrics_host: metrics.druwyn.zemvarlabs.internal
  tenant: sorius
  seal: seal_798a43d7

## Queuescale Basics

Queuescale polls broker queue depth every 15 seconds and adjusts worker replicas between the floor and ceiling set in `limits.yaml`. Scaling decisions are logged to the `decisions` table so you can reconstruct any incident timeline. If the poller itself is down, replicas freeze at their last count. It reaches its state database via the following connection string.

database URL for fajeg-bawig: mssql://kaswyn_svc:d8oYa4Z@db-b37d.norvasys.example:5432/gorael

## Webhook Retry Semantics

The Dravano event bus retries failed webhook deliveries with exponential backoff: 30s, 2m, 10m, 1h, then hourly up to 24 attempts. A delivery counts as failed on any non-2xx response or a 10s timeout. Retries stop early if the endpoint returns 410. Duplicate deliveries are possible; consumers must dedupe on `event_id`. To replay a dead-lettered batch manually, call the Hollis replay endpoint on the internal admin plane, authenticating with the key below.

gateway credential: kto23_LX9A4ys6i4nzHtpOLNLodKK